A two-year-old boy was fatally struck by a car Friday night in South Philadelphia after running between parked cars while chasing a ball.

He was hit by a 2002 Izusu in the 1300 block of Catharine Street around 6:10 p.m. Friday, said Lt. Fran Vanore. His parents brought him to Children's Hospital of Philadelphia, where he was pronounced dead around 6:30 p.m. He died of massive head trauma.

Philly.com has identified the boy as Ikie Jones Jr., although police would not confirm this.

The driver of the Izusu remained at the scene and did not appear to be under the influence of any substance.
